Форум программистов, компьютерный форум, киберфорум
Наши страницы
VBScript/JScript/WSH/WMI/HTA
Войти
Регистрация
Восстановить пароль
 
Рейтинг 4.60/5: Рейтинг темы: голосов - 5, средняя оценка - 4.60
shavka
130 / 13 / 2
Регистрация: 27.11.2013
Сообщений: 341
1

Где писать VBS

14.01.2018, 23:43. Просмотров 948. Ответов 13
Метки нет (Все метки)

Правильно ли я понимаю, что VBS можно в 10м Офисе писать в VBA-редакторе? Или нужно что-то устанавливать? VBS ведь родной для Винды, если я правильно понял.
0
Лучшие ответы (1)
Надоела реклама? Зарегистрируйтесь и она исчезнет полностью.
Similar
Эксперт
41792 / 34177 / 6122
Регистрация: 12.04.2006
Сообщений: 57,940
14.01.2018, 23:43
Ответы с готовыми решениями:

Создание бинарного файла из vbs / Как создать exe файл из vbs
Имеется файл с расширением exe. Нужно как-нибудь занести массив байт в скрипт,...

Vbs
Добрый вечер, прошу помощи!!! Имеется file.txt, внутри построчно написаны...

C# в VBS
Добрый день ребят подскажите возможно ли реализовать вот этот код в VBS с...

VBS и iFrame
Ребята есть такой VBScript: Option Explicit Dim objWshShell Set...

VBS decode
Здравствуйте, Очень надеюсь что кто-нибудь сможет подсказать как быть... Есть...

13
volodin661
1844 / 901 / 153
Регистрация: 10.12.2013
Сообщений: 3,039
15.01.2018, 09:27 2
установить MS Visual Studio.

для работы с отладчиком запускать так из ком. строки:
Windows Batch file
1
cscript.exe /x "file.vbs"
1
FlasherX
740 / 297 / 114
Регистрация: 06.06.2017
Сообщений: 1,105
15.01.2018, 10:52 3
shavka, vbS-скрипт тем и отличается от vbA-макроса, что для него необязателен запуск из оболочки приложения, если код не в hta/html. Это исполняемый файл, запускающийся как и любой cmd/bat/exe/com/etc.

Цитата Сообщение от volodin661 Посмотреть сообщение
установить MS Visual Studio.
Для каких целей? Госдума не одобрила запуск "искаропки"?
1
shavka
130 / 13 / 2
Регистрация: 27.11.2013
Сообщений: 341
15.01.2018, 11:10  [ТС] 4
FlasherX, ну тогда видимо можно писать в блокноте и сохранять как исполняемый файл? Просто я всю жисть писал тока в VBA, хватало. А щас настигла жестокая необходимость, потому вопросы наивные.
0
FlasherX
740 / 297 / 114
Регистрация: 06.06.2017
Сообщений: 1,105
15.01.2018, 11:20 5
shavka, блокнот это будет или нормальный редактор с подсветкой синтаксиса и IntelliSense — вопрос предпочтений. Сохранять с расширением .vbs, привязанный же к нему реестром интерпретатор и делает файл исполняемым.
1
volodin661
1844 / 901 / 153
Регистрация: 10.12.2013
Сообщений: 3,039
15.01.2018, 12:04 6
Цитата Сообщение от FlasherX Посмотреть сообщение
Для каких целей?
Visual Studio в качестве отладчика главным образом.
Да и в хозяйстве пригодится.
1
FlasherX
740 / 297 / 114
Регистрация: 06.06.2017
Сообщений: 1,105
15.01.2018, 13:24 7
Для vbs нет смысла. Много лишнего и медленно. Microsoft Script Debugger (scd10en.exe) тогда уж. Хотя сам предпочитаю другие вещи.
1
shavka
130 / 13 / 2
Регистрация: 27.11.2013
Сообщений: 341
15.01.2018, 14:02  [ТС] 8
FlasherX,
Цитата Сообщение от FlasherX Посмотреть сообщение
Microsoft Script Debugger (scd10en.exe)
Его нужно где-то скачивать?
0
FlasherX
740 / 297 / 114
Регистрация: 06.06.2017
Сообщений: 1,105
15.01.2018, 14:15 9
Лучший ответ Сообщение было отмечено shavka как решение

Решение

shavka, да. Или, может, уже есть MSE7.exe в папках офиса? Если нет, то см. как ставить.
1
volodin661
1844 / 901 / 153
Регистрация: 10.12.2013
Сообщений: 3,039
15.01.2018, 15:42 10
Цитата Сообщение от FlasherX Посмотреть сообщение
Для vbs нет смысла. Много лишнего и медленно.
Гражданам, пользующимся в 2018-м году от РХ vbscript-ом, спешить-то уже некуда. приплыли.
1
shavka
130 / 13 / 2
Регистрация: 27.11.2013
Сообщений: 341
15.01.2018, 17:34  [ТС] 11
FlasherX, а почему MS не включили MSE в 10й офис? У меня 10й. Западло. Вроде как должны совершенствоваться, а они вон какую подлянку кинули. Бегай теперь, извращайся, ставь непонятно что. Просто у меня принцип, что неопытному юзеру лучше не ставить посторонний софт, проблемсков будет меньше, а контроля - больше.

Зато у меня в папке ProgramFiles есть Visual Studio8. Там есть папка Debugger. Она пустая. Да и вообще никак не пойму, как его ставить, этот VS. тоже никак не допру. Через сайт MSO?
0
FlasherX
740 / 297 / 114
Регистрация: 06.06.2017
Сообщений: 1,105
15.01.2018, 22:24 12

Не по теме:

Цитата Сообщение от volodin661 Посмотреть сообщение
Гражданам, пользующимся в 2018-м году от РХ vbscript-ом, спешить-то уже некуда. приплыли.
Так и не пользуйтесь, уплывайте в другие разделы и не пишите в этот. Проще некуда. Более доступного и простого языка на разных версиях Windows, не требующего консоли, .NET и установочных танцев с бубном, нет. Так что граждане довольствуются тем, что можно запустить на 99,9% рабочих под WinOS машин с одного тектовичка.


shavka, это вопрос не ко мне. С переходом на Edge они вообще остановили развитие (поддержку) этих языков на Win10+. Такие подлянки для мелкомягких — не редкость. А что значит "непонятно что"? И в чём, собственно, может быть контроль? Скрипты юзеры отлаживать будут?
0
shavka
130 / 13 / 2
Регистрация: 27.11.2013
Сообщений: 341
16.01.2018, 02:10  [ТС] 13
FlasherX,

Цитата Сообщение от FlasherX Посмотреть сообщение
А что значит "непонятно что"? И в чём, собственно, может быть контроль? Скрипты юзеры отлаживать будут?
Ну как же. MS - монтстер, помрет не скоро, поддержка у него мощная, всех, кто толковый, жрет пачками. Если мелкий девелопер протянет ноги, кто поддерживать будет продукт? Неопытный юзер же не сможет. Потом для Винды все продукты MS максимально адаптированы, а если со сторонними прогами что не так, как дилетанту разбираться? Куча геморров. К MS хотя бы обратиться можно за помощью. Устанавливаю я прогу - как мне отследить, какие файлы, каких расширений где установились? Эт я уже про вирусы. Устанавливая продукты MS, хотя бы я уверен, что вирусняк не понахватаю. Короче, дилетантам надо держаться самого толстого и наглого. А куда нам, сирым и беспомощным, деваться?

Добавлено через 2 минуты
Цитата Сообщение от FlasherX Посмотреть сообщение
С переходом на Edge они вообще остановили развитие (поддержку) этих языков на Win10+.
думаю, они свои .net продукты продвигают, патаму и убрали. Net-продукты выгоднее. Вот тут их смерть и ждет - не.. нас дрессировать. Никому не удавалось.
0
FlasherX
740 / 297 / 114
Регистрация: 06.06.2017
Сообщений: 1,105
16.01.2018, 04:25 14
shavka

Не по теме:

Цитата Сообщение от shavka
Потом для Винды все продукты MS максимально адаптированы, а если со сторонними прогами что не так, как дилетанту разбираться?
Максимально адаптированы подо что? Косяков везде хватает. И дилетанту хотя бы основы языка изучить надо перед тем, как выстраивать свои алгоритмы на отладочных изысканиях.
Цитата Сообщение от shavka
К MS хотя бы обратиться можно за помощью.
И как успехи? Чаще сводится к "это не предусмотрено", то "нельзя", "попробуйте что-то другое" и т. п.
Цитата Сообщение от shavka
Устанавливаю я прогу - как мне отследить, какие файлы, каких расширений где установились? Эт я уже про вирусы.
Варианты известны. Песочница, сравнения снимков в каком-нибудь System Explorer, всяческие анинсталлеры. А по части вирусов Virus Total в помощь. Только какое это имеет отношение к проверенным или никак не тянущим на зловредов средствам?
Цитата Сообщение от shavka
Устанавливая продукты MS, хотя бы я уверен, что вирусняк не понахватаю. Короче, дилетантам надо держаться самого толстого и наглого. А куда нам, сирым и беспомощным, деваться?
Сомнительная позиция. Верить в порядочность продукции MS, несмотря на то, что она с каждой новой версией или пакетом всячески усиливает слежку, отправляя инфу на свои сервера, задабривая латанием очередной кипы дыр.
Цитата Сообщение от shavka
Net-продукты выгоднее. Вот тут их смерть и ждет - не.. нас дрессировать. Никому не удавалось.
Выгоднее одним, но невыгоднее другим. Мелкософт всё за всех решил, не давая права выбора. Смерть кого ждёт? Тех, кого вы только что обласкали максимальной адаптивностью? Системная дрессировка никуда не денется, подавляющий захват рынка новыми версиями - лишь вопрос времени. Упомянутый дилетантизм и погоня за новым этому весьма способствуют.

0
16.01.2018, 04:25
MoreAnswers
Эксперт
37091 / 29110 / 5898
Регистрация: 17.06.2006
Сообщений: 43,301
16.01.2018, 04:25

vbs и excel
хелпппппппппппп! помогите кодом vbs. ситуация. есть некий файл ексель(имя...

Prnqctl.vbs
Добрый день. С некоторых пор стал долго выполнятся стандартный встроенный в...

Мануал vbs
Кто-нить может подсказать хороший мануал по VBS, с примерами и т.д.? Пошарился...


Искать еще темы с ответами

Или воспользуйтесь поиском по форуму:
14
Ответ Создать тему
Опции темы

К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2018, vBulletin Solutions, Inc.
Рейтинг@Mail.ru